Baidu Takes Measures to Comply with Government Directives

BEIJING, April 9, 2020 /PRNewswire/ -- Baidu, Inc. (NASDAQ: BIDU) ("Baidu" or the "Company"), a leading search engine, knowledge and information centered Internet platform and AI company, today announced that pursuant to directives of relevant PRC regulators, Baidu has suspended updating its content on certain newsfeeds channels within Baidu App and conduct maintenance, beginning from April 8, 2020. The Company expects that the suspension may have impact on the marketing services revenue related to the suspended channels.

The Company will undertake additional measures to fully comply with the directives of the regulators, including enhancing its monitoring and management over its platform, strengthening the quality and integrity of content on its platform, and continuing to improve its business practices to provide better services to users.

Apart from the suspended newsfeed channels within Baidu App, Baidu App maintains normal operation.
